Drifting

The moon kisses the deepest ocean
Its dance upon it, a tender motion
How does the ocean flow without knowing?
Is there a reason for it to keep going?

Mystic moon what keeps you from staying?
Is it the waves that call you from playing?
I wonder if the stars tell of love thats mine
Gentle blue will you prevent their shine?

I look up to the heavens in the shrouded sky
Will you blanket my heartfelt sighs?
Just only one star for my loving wish
I send it to you, my love I miss

I sit here now upon the warmest sands
Watching constellations waving their hands
They echo a story in the lowest of sound
Deepest blue within your song they drown?

Softly now pillowy words are singing
Here by the blue my mind stays drifting
With fragile thoughts I am still believing
I see him there, no I must be dreaming
